Output ec88afebb89b6c3cf075dfb763f494aac30dfad0ff152d4d59b91f7e9d5b775a:0

value
2433955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b74f6941c370ed480e669aeb4bfac7687535137a OP_EQUAL
address
3JQGiETV9AK5Q1q6szstKvvvrrSnjDT87b
transaction
ec88afebb89b6c3cf075dfb763f494aac30dfad0ff152d4d59b91f7e9d5b775a
spent
true